  2. the feeling of being annoyed, especially because you can do nothing to solve a problem: exasperation at There is growing exasperation within the government at the failure of these policies to reduce unemployment. in exasperation After ten hours of fruitless negotiations, he stormed out of the meeting in exasperation.

    How do you use exasperated in a sentence?To wield it effectively, one must consider both its syntactical placement and the context in which it is used. Like many adjectives, “exasperated” is most commonly used to modify nouns, providing a descriptive element to the sentence. For example: “She let out an exasperated sigh.” “His exasperated tone revealed his impatience.”
